Molybdenum and molybdenum alloys have good thermal conductivity, conductivity, lower coefficient of thermal expansion, significant-temperature energy, low vapor strain, and have on resistance. For that reason, they are getting to be essential resources for Digital and electric power equipment manufacturing, metallic material processing, glass manufacturing, superior-temperature furnace structural component production, and aerospace and protection business purposes.

The appliance of Molybdenum and Molybdenum Alloys while in the Production of Electronic and Energy Gear

The manufacturing of Digital energy equipment is the principle application of molybdenum and molybdenum alloy. For instance, reduced thermal enlargement products made use of as filaments, lights and electronic tube factors, microwave products, health care electronic appliances, internal elements of X-ray tubes, X-ray flaw detectors, built-in circuit components, and many others.


Molybdenum could also form Cu/Mo/Cu (CMC) composite elements with copper . Among the many steel, copper can improve the thermal growth perform of composite supplies, enabling them to raised match With all the ceramic matrix.


The application of molybdenum and molybdenum alloys in the fabric processing market

one. Applied to be a incredibly hot Functioning mold

During the aerospace industry, molybdenum alloys are generally accustomed to manufacture molds for top-temperature solid engine areas.

2. Employed for molten metal processing

Aluminum foundries use molybdenum to suppress the new cracking of their processed materials. The TZM (Titanium Zirconium Molybdenum) alloy Main and Main rod (rod) are generally utilized to method parts of resources which can be vulnerable to thermal cracking, which can prevent materials thermal cracking. The appliance of TZM and MHC alloy can improve the swift solidification capability of processing equipment. Tungsten molybdenum alloys hold the exact corrosion resistance and can considerably reduce output prices. Thus, Mo-twenty five% W and Mo-thirty% W alloys are already produced for use in impellers, pump units, and molten zinc pipeline devices.


three. Useful for thermal spraying treatment

The piston rings may be thermally sprayed with molybdenum. This process includes mixing molybdenum powder with an adhesive made up of nickel (Ni) and chromium (Cr) and after that plasma spraying the mixture onto the piston. The spraying may be pure molybdenum or molybdenum alloy mixed powder, don-resistant and corrosion-resistant, suitable for the papermaking business. And molybdenum powder may also be mixed with various contents of nickel, chromium, boron, and silicon powder to type various powder mixtures. Even so, the sprayed powder involves excellent fluidity, along with the thermal sprayed powder, right after spraying, ought to generally be spherical or somewhere around spherical. And also the blended powder of Mo and Mo alloy may be used for plasma nozzles to compact into pre-alloy powders of different features, which might be a lot more don-resistant and corrosion-resistant.

4. Employed for chemical remedy

Using molybdenum being an electrode material in glass melting processing can impenhance the processing ability of conventional furnaces. As a consequence of its substantial-temperature strength and thermal security, molybdenum is suitable for substantial-temperature furnace components. By way of example, molybdenum and molybdenum alloys are generally employed as materials for hot isostatic urgent (HIP) equipment, heating factors, sleeves, and brackets. Usually employed molybdenum fixtures and sintered molybdenum boats in ceramics; Pretty much all oxide ceramic goods generated in the electronics sector are fired applying molybdenum carriers. Additionally, resulting from its compatibility with hot gases and higher-temperature power, molybdenum can even be Employed in the aerospace and protection industries. However, the bad antioxidant Homes of molybdenum limit its software.
